引言

区块链技术自从比特币的提出以来,已经在全球范围内引起了广泛的关注与应用。在这场技术革命中,区块链并不只是单一的数字货币概念,而是一种去中心化、透明、安全的信息记录技术,其应用前景几乎无所不在。随着技术的不断发展,已经出现了多种区块链技术平台,其中比较核心的三大技术平台是比特币平台、以太坊平台和超 ledger Fabric平台。本文将一一解析这三大区块链技术平台,帮助读者深入了解它们的特点及应用。

一、比特币平台

比特币是第一个成功应用区块链技术的数字货币,是通过区块链技术创造的金融生态系统的代表。比特币网络的核心是基于工作量证明(PoW)的共识机制。以下是对比特币平台的详细解析。

1.1 比特币平台的基本架构

比特币的架构非常简单,由节点、区块、链和钱包构成。节点在网络中分布式运行,负责验证交易和维护账本;区块是记录交易信息的数据单元,而链则是这些区块按照时间顺序串联在一起,确保数据的不可篡改性;钱包则是用户存储比特币的地方。

1.2 比特币的工作机制

比特币使用的工作量证明机制要求矿工通过解决复杂的数学题来验证交易。这一过程不仅确保了网络的安全性,还增加了新比特币的发行。虽然这一机制确保了安全性,但在效率上也存在问题,导致交易速度较慢和资源消耗高。

1.3 比特币的应用案例

比特币作为一种数字货币,最直接的应用是在支付和转账方面。其中,由于其去中心化特性,使得用户可以在全球范围内快速、安全地进行交易。此外,比特币也被用于价值存储和投资,成为一种数字“黄金”。

二、以太坊平台

以太坊是第二代区块链平台,除了数字货币功能外,它还引入了智能合约(Smart Contract)的概念。以太坊的目标是创造一个去中心化的应用平台,让开发者可以构建和发布各种去中心化应用程序(DApps)。

2.1 以太坊的基本架构

以太坊平台的核心是一个去中心化的虚拟机(EVM),它可以执行智能合约。以太坊网络结构同样由节点、区块和链组成,节点负责处理智能合约的执行,并维护区块链的完整性。

2.2 智能合约的工作机制

智能合约是以太坊的核心,它是自我执行的合约,当设定条件满足时,会自动执行预定的操作。智能合约的代码一经部署,便无法被篡改,这也为信任机制的建设提供了新思路。此外,由于智能合约可以用于各种复杂的场景,诸如金融服务、供应链管理、版权保护等,使得以太坊成为开发者和企业青睐的平台。

2.3 以太坊的应用案例

以太坊在金融科技领域得到了广泛应用,如去中心化金融(DeFi)、不可替代代币(NFT)等。其中,DeFi项目允许用户在无需中介的情况下进行借贷、交易,而NFT则为数字艺术、游戏资产和其他创作提供了全新的交易方式。

三、超 ledger Fabric平台

Hyperledger Fabric是由Linux基金会领导的区块链项目,专注于为企业提供可定制的区块链解决方案。与比特币和以太坊不同,Hyperledger Fabric并不是一个公有链,而是一个许可链(Permissioned Blockchain)。

3.1 超 ledger Fabric的基本架构

Hyperledger Fabric采用模块化设计,不同于以太坊的智能合约,Fabric使用链码作为处理逻辑。它允许单个网络中运行多个链,具有高灵活性和可扩展性,适应不同企业的需求。

3.2 超 ledger Fabric的工作机制

Hyperledger Fabric支持多种共识机制,企业可以根据具体需求来选择最优的共识方式。此外,Fabric提供了角色管理,可以指定哪些参与者有权查看和处理交易,增强了隐私保护。

3.3 超 ledger Fabric的应用案例

Hyperledger Fabric在供应链管理、金融服务和保险等行业得到了广泛应用。例如,在供应链管理中,通过区块链技术,可以精准追溯每个环节,增强透明度,降低作假风险。而在金融和保险领域,则可以有效提高结算效率和减少欺诈行为。

总结

区块链技术在发展的过程中,涌现出了多种技术平台。比特币以其独特的数字货币价值,成为了区块链的先锋;以太坊则通过引入智能合约和去中心化应用,推动了区块链在各个行业的广泛应用;而超 ledger Fabric则为企业提供了一个灵活、可定制的区块链解决方案,助力传统行业数字化转型。这三大区块链技术平台各具特色,在未来的数字经济时代,相信它们将在各个领域持续发光发热。

相关问题解析

区块链技术如何改变传统行业?

区块链技术的去中心化、不可篡改和透明性为传统行业带来了革命性的变化。比如在金融领域,区块链减少了中介环节,提高了交易速度以及降低了成本。在供应链管理中,区块链可以追踪产品的来源及流动,提高了透明度,降低了作假风险。医疗行业则可通过区块链技术实现病历的共享和保护,提高了数据的安全性以及患者的隐私,同时也为研究提供了可靠的数据支持。教育领域也在探索通过区块链记录学位证书,以防伪造。总之,区块链通过重塑信任机制,为传统行业解决了许多痛点,提高了效率。

以太坊的智能合约是如何工作的?

智能合约是一种自动执行的合约,其代码在以太坊网络中运行,设定好的条件满足时,合约内容就会被自动执行。例如,在一个借贷协议中,当借款人将抵押物放入合约中时,合约会自动转移相应数量的以太坊给借款人。一旦条件满足,合约会执行还款操作,从而确保双方的权益。由于智能合约的代码是公开透明的,这也为互动提供了信任基础,减少了合同执行的纠纷。此外,智能合约的可编程性和灵活性使得它能够广泛应用于金融、供应链、游戏等各个领域。

比特币和以太坊有什么区别?

比特币和以太坊是两种不同的区块链技术。比特币主要作为数字货币存在,旨在实现一个去中心化的支付网络,它的主要功能是转账和支付。而以太坊不仅支持数字货币的交易,还引入了智能合约,能够实现去中心化的应用程序开发。技术上, 比特币使用工作量证明机制(PoW),而以太坊计划在未来过渡到权益证明机制(PoS)。此外,比特币的总发行量是2100万枚,而以太坊没有硬性上限,这使得两者也在经济模型上有所不同。总体而言,比特币更偏重数字货币, 而以太坊则会致力于建立一个去中心化的计算平台。

超 ledger Fabric与其他区块链平台相比有何优势?

Hyperledger Fabric相比于比特币和以太坊,其最大优势在于它的模块化设计与灵活性。企业可以根据自身的需求,自定义其网络构架、共识机制以及隐私设置。此外,Hyperledger Fabric支持许可网络,意味着企业参与者可以控制谁能加入网络,这在处理敏感数据时尤为重要。此外,超 ledger Fabric支持链码(smart contract),可以灵活地用多种编程语言来实现,更加方便开发者进行应用开发。总体而言,Hyperledger Fabric更适合企业级的应用,在安全性和隐私性方面有着独特的优势。

区块链的未来发展趋势是什么?

随着技术的不断发展和市场需求的变化,区块链将会面临许多新的发展趋势。首先,跨链技术将会成为趋势,不同区块链之间的互联互通将会大大增强其应用灵活性。其次,隐私保护机制将会得到更多关注,结合零知识证明等技术,确保参与者数据安全的同时,仍能进行透明的交易。另外,区块链与人工智能、物联网等其他技术的结合,也会催生出新的应用场景,比如智能合约与AI结合可以实现更为复杂的决策。最后,监管框架将逐渐形成,确保行业在健康的轨道上发展。随着社会对于去中心化、自主、安全的需求增加,区块链的应用前景依然广阔。

最终,区块链技术的发展对于我们生活的方方面面产生深刻影响,理解这些技术平台的特点和应用,将为我们更好地适应未来的技术趋势奠定基础。